Definitions from Wiktionary (exclude)
▸ verb: (transitive) To bar (someone or something) from entering; to keep out.
▸ verb: (transitive) To expel; to put out.
▸ verb: (transitive) To omit from consideration.
▸ verb: (transitive, law) To refuse to accept (evidence) as valid.
▸ verb: (transitive, medicine) To eliminate from diagnostic consideration.
